My last period lasted 12 days, and now I am 8 days late. I have taken two pregnancy tests, both negative. However, I have been vomiting 9 out of the last 11 days, and certain smells trigger nausea. My periods are usually regular, except for last month and this month. What could be causing these symptoms, and should I take another pregnancy test or see a doctor?
Answered by 1 Apollo Doctors
Despite negative tests, symptoms suggest possible early pregnancy. Repeat a Beta hCG blood test for confirmation. If negative again, check for hormonal imbalance or gastritis. Do TSH, Prolactin, and Pelvic Ultrasound. Consult gynecologist if symptoms persist.
